gcc: update compiler architecture to match gcc-runtime (armv6, armv7a)
The gcc-runtime recipe builds the gcc libraries including libstdc++ with $TARGET_CC_ARCH flags, which include -march=FOO flags that affect whether atomic instructions are available. This causes an ABI incompatibility when the compiler by default generates code for less capable architectures. For example, gcc-runtime libraries on a Cortex-A8 are built with a different C++11/C++14 mutex implementation than is used code compiled outside OE and without architecture-specific flags. This commit fixes the problem specifically for ABI issues related to atomic instructions available in ARMV6 and subsequent architectures. Other ABI incompatibilities may remain in other architectures. +# ARMv6+ adds atomic instructions that affect the ABI in libraries built
+# with TUNE_CCARGS in gcc-runtime. Make the compiler default to a
+# compatible architecture. armv6 and armv7a cover the minimum tune
+# features used in OE.
+EXTRA_OECONF_append_armv6 = " --with-arch=armv6"
+EXTRA_OECONF_append_armv7a = " --with-arch=armv7-a"
